COVALENT FUNCTIONALIZATION OF MWCNT FOR BETTER DISPERSION IN POLYMER MATRICES

Because of their unique structure and physical properties carbon nanotubes draw a lot of attention. Properties like large interfacial contact area, high stiffness and strength, great thermal and electrical conductivity, high aspect ratio and low mass density make them ideal reinforcement fillers. However, due to the Van der Waals interactions it is very challenging to prevent the agglomeration of carbon nanotubes in bundles. That's why an appropriate chemical treatment of the nanotube surface is required for a fine dispersion to be accomplished. Another reason for their surface functionalization is achieving better or specific interaction between carbon nanotubes and polymer matrix. In this work covalent modification of multiwall carbon nanotubes (MWCNT) was performed which has enabled introduction of new alkyl ending on carbon nanotube surface by ester or amide linkage. Modified MWCNT were characterized by spectroscopic and thermal methods.
